A Graduate Certificate in Financial Planning for STEM Professionals bridges the gap between technical expertise and financial acumen, equipping graduates with the knowledge and skills to manage personal and professional finances effectively. This focused program provides a strong foundation in financial planning principles tailored specifically for STEM professionals.
Learning outcomes for this certificate include mastering investment strategies, retirement planning, tax optimization, and risk management techniques. Students will gain proficiency in financial modeling and analysis, crucial skills highly valued in the finance industry and applicable to various STEM career paths. The curriculum often incorporates case studies and real-world applications to ensure practical relevance.
The duration of a Graduate Certificate in Financial Planning for STEM Professionals typically ranges from 9 to 18 months, depending on the program's intensity and course load. The program is designed to be flexible, often allowing STEM professionals to pursue it alongside their current employment, facilitating career advancement without significant disruption.
